How much do remote pharma j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 5,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ote pharma in Virginia is $125,941.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$108,100.00 and $142,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ote pharma job?

A Remote Pharma job refers to a position in the pharmaceutical industry that allows employees to work from a location outside of a traditional office, often from home. These roles can include positions in regulatory affairs, medical writing, sales, clinical trial management, and pharmacovigilance, among others. Remote Pharma jobs leverage digital communication and project management tools to collaborate with team members and clients. This setup offers greater flexibility and can help companies access a broader talent pool while maintaining productivity and compliance.

OVERVIEW

Associate Principals are methodologic experts with substantial experience in providing consulting services to Pharmaceutical clients. Associate Principals are project leaders who are responsible for implementing rigorous evidence synthesis research, overseeing the work of junior staff, and proactively managing the project timeline. They are detail oriented, act on anticipated project needs, and problem solve. Associate Principals contribute to the operational and fiscal health of the overall practice and training/success of junior staff.

REQUIRED KNOWLEDGE

Excellent knowledge of systematic literature review (SLR) methods and indirect treatment comparison (ITC). Significant experience leading and conducting ITC projects, including network meta-analysis, matching adjusted meta-analysis, etc. Expert understanding of global SLR guidelines and best practices, and substantial experience in implementing them.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Lead implementation of evidence synthesis projects to support HTA and/or regulatory submissions from pre-award to final delivery, as well as hands on development of deliverables
  • Lead project teams to ensure the execution of rigorous and high quality deliverables according to timelines
  • Expert ability to synthesize data qualitatively and quantitatively, and guide junior staff
  • Project management-manage projects, oversee the operational, financial, and administrative requirements of projects
  • Business development-independently qualify leads, develop proposals, attend bid defenses, and manage the contracting process
  • Support more senior staff on specific business initiatives as required
  • Work effectively across time zones as part of a global team
